I nominate Cathy Sullivan for the DAISY Award. I have had the privilege of witnessing her great kindness and outstanding nursing practice for the 8 years I have worked at WMC. Her signature nursing style reflects integrity and compassion and reminds me of Mother Teresa’s words, “in this life we cannot do great things, we can only do small things with great love.

As demanding as nursing is, Cathy always seems to find the time for kindness, and she in unwavering and seamless in her professional practice; her patients and their families experience and trust her commitment to service. They know that she will be there for them, helping them to navigate a complex and sometimes stressful experience.

If I had to describe what I value most about Cathy as my colleague, it would be her quality of consistent patience and thoughtfulness. I have the deepest respect not only for her nursing knowledge and expertise but also for the generosity with which she shares it. She has a way of always making your problem her problem; and your patient her patient.

Working with Cathy is inspiring. She is truly a light in our midst, a blessing to all of us.
